Description:
Mandelonitrile, with the CAS number 532-28-5, is an organic compound characterized by its cyanohydrin structure, specifically derived from benzaldehyde and hydrogen cyanide. It appears as a colorless to pale yellow liquid and has a distinctive almond-like odor, which is attributed to its structural similarity to benzaldehyde. The compound is known for its reactivity, particularly in nucleophilic addition reactions, due to the presence of both a nitrile and a hydroxyl group. Mandelonitrile is soluble in water and organic solvents, making it versatile in various chemical applications. It is often used in organic synthesis, particularly in the production of pharmaceuticals and agrochemicals. Additionally, mandelonitrile can undergo hydrolysis to yield mandelic acid, further expanding its utility in chemical processes. However, it should be handled with care due to its potential toxicity and the presence of cyanide, which poses health risks. Proper safety measures and protocols are essential when working with this compound in laboratory or industrial settings.
